For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public elementary school serving 156 students in 69343, NE.
The top-ranked public elementary school in 69343, NE is Gordon-rushville Elem-gordon.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public elementary school in zipcode 69343 have an average math proficiency score of 62% (versus the Nebraska public elementary school average of 60%), and reading proficiency score of 47% (versus the 47% statewide average). Elementary schools in 69343, NE have an average ranking of 4/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Nebraska public elementary schools.
Minority enrollment is 44% of the student body (majority American Indian), which is more than the Nebraska public elementary school average of 40% (majority Hispanic).
